Then, slowly, hundreds of macaws and parrots arrive \u2014 blue, red, green, yellow \u2014 perching and feeding in a cacophony of color and sound.<\/p><p>The <strong>Sandoval Lake<\/strong> is another highlight. After a 5 km jungle walk \u2014 sometimes on wooden boardwalks over marshes \u2014 you reach the tranquil lake. There, you\u2019ll paddle silently in a canoe, spotting <strong>giant river otters<\/strong>, <strong>caimans<\/strong>, turtles, and countless bird species.<\/p><p>The <strong>eco-lodges<\/strong> here are top-tier \u2014 comfortable rooms (some even with jacuzzis), excellent food, and expert naturalist guides who know the forest intimately. Night walks reveal an entirely different world \u2014 tarantulas, glowing insects, colorful frogs, and eyes shining back at your flashlight beam.<\/p><p><strong>Practical tip:<\/strong> Lodges are 1\u20133 hours away by boat; the further you go, the more wildlife you\u2019ll see. Bring long-sleeved clothing, repellent, boots, binoculars, and a camera with good zoom. Nature shows itself on its own time \u2014 patience is key.<\/p>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>PUERTO MALDONADO PUERTO MALDONADO Altitude: 183 m | Climate: 24\u201332\u00b0C | Hot and humid, rainiest December\u2013MarchHow to get there: Flight from Lima (1.5 hours) or Cusco (30 minutes); road from Cusco (10 hours) More accessible than Iquitos, Puerto Maldonado offers some of the richest biodiversity on the planet in the Tambopata National Reserve.
